Post Job Free
Sign in

Engineer Test

Location:
Massachusetts
Posted:
November 28, 2018

Contact this candidate

Resume:

Ramya Modugu

Senior QA Automation Engineer

E-mail: ***********.****@*****.***

Phone: 321-***-****

Senior QA Automation Engineer with 8 years of experience in all phases of Software Testing Life Cycle (STLC). Preparing Test strategy, Test plan, Test methodology, Test scenarios, Test summary reports, Test cases and Test documents for both Automation and Manual testing based on User requirements, System requirements and Use case documents in various domains such as Finance, Healthcare, Banking, Retail and Ecommerce.

CERTIFICATIONS

ISTQB Certified

Brain Bench Java certified

Microsoft Technology Associate Developer and database certified.

PROFESSIONAL SUMMARY

Extensively involved in UI Automation by using Selenium Webdriver, Java, SOAP UI testing, Database SQL Testing, Web application testing, and designing Unit Testing framework.

Well versed with Software Development Life Cycle (SDLC), Software Testing Life Cycle (STLC), Logging and Tracking Defects in all the phases with major responsibilities.

Expertise in implementing Waterfall / Agile and SCRUM Methodology by analyzing requirement specifications and responsible for developing Test Objective, strategies, Scope, Test procedures and Test Metrics.

Expertise in GUI testing, Web Application testing, Standalone Application testing, Build acceptance testing (BAT), Business Process Testing (BPT),Functionality testing, Integration testing, Regression testing, Retesting, Exploratory testing, Black Box and White box testing.

Expertise in developing the framework for automation from the scratch for the newly proposed projects using BPT Framework and Hybrid Framework.

Expertise in automating API Third Party Tools using Web services through UFT and SoapUI.

Formulate &Develop effective Test Architecture per organizational needs.

Pro-actively analyze current processes and practices and suggest/ drive improvements and also defines processes as needed

Driving organization-wide Quality Process initiatives and their implementation to ensure quality of deliverables.

Experience in SDLC methodologies such as Waterfall and Agile/SCRUM.

Proficient in analyzing Business Requirements, Functional and Technical specifications, User Requirements, Performing GAP Analysis and Test estimation.

Pro-actively seeks to make continuous improvements to Test coverage, execution and

automation.

Expertise in developing scripts for Mobile Applications using UFT.

Expertise in testing hardware Devices using mock tools and Emulators through UFT Developed Scripts.

Analyzes competitive products and technologies and makes appropriate suggestions (may use demos, POC) to influence product / technology direction.

Created automation testing framework using VB Scripting with QTP, using JScript inTest Complete, using Java in Selenium.

Expertise Defect Management/Problem Solving including tracking bugs, reporting using Application Life Cycle Management (ALM), Quality Center (QC), Agile Manager, Serena Dimensions, Test Director, Bugzilla, Jenkins, Cucumber and JIRA.

Expert in functional automation testing using QTP, UFT, Selenium, Test Complete and Nonfunctional testing using LOADRUNNER and Jmeter.

Experience in Database testing using Complex SQL Queries with help of Tools likePl/SQl Developer, Toad, Microsoft Management Studio Sequel Server.

Extensively used various features of automation testing including checkpoints, object Repositories, Function Libraries, Output values, Data driven testing, regular expressions, synchronization techniques, Virtual Objects, Data table objects,transactions, Exception Handling, object Recognition, reporting mechanism and script debugging using VBScript for business process testing.

Proficient in designing, developing, implementing and documenting test cases for back-endtesting in Oracle, DB2 and SQL server

Expert in identifying the reusable code and creating reusable actions, functions and libraries to integrate with the framework.

Hands on experience in testing GUI applications, SOA gateway, Web Applications, WebServices, Client-Server, Data Warehouse and good knowledge of web technologies like Web Services, SOAP, XML, HTML and JavaScript.

Experience in writing NUNIT, JUNIT Test Frameworks in Eclipse IDE environment.

Experienced in working with global teams across the world with geographical and cultural barriers and at both on-shore and off-shore offices.

Excellent knowledge in cross browser testing and SQL database testing.

Hands-on experience in web performance test and load test on production systems.

Hands-on experience in web services testing using standards like XML, WSDL, SOAP andJava Message Service.

Participated in requirement review meetings, analyzing requirements, developing test plan and test cases, Requirement Traceability Matrix, Defect management, Reporting and tracking.

Experience using SOAPUI tool for Web Services for validating request and response XML/REST/JSON.

Automation Testing on .Net, Java, WPF Developed Applications.

Involved in developing and executing Test plan and Test Cases for Functional and Regression testing.

Developed test cases for Regression, and Data Driven tests using automated test tools.

Working experience with on site and off shore team based on the schedules.

Strong knowledge and experienced in creating functions libraries and generic functions using VB Script for automation and experienced in creating test reports in VB scripts using Quality Center,Data integrated QTP tests with QC.

Expertise in executing VU-Gen scripts in Load Runner for Performance, Load and Stress

Testing using Controller in Load Runner and generated reports using the Analysis tool in Load Runner.

Knowledge of performance bottlenecks, end-to- end performance, and web performance measures like server response time, throughput and network latency.

Hands-on experience in Black Box Testing, White box testing, Unit Testing, User acceptance testing, Functional, Integration, GUI, System, Usability, Regression, Performance, Security and Stress Testing.

Proficiency in data base Testing using Structured Query Language (SQL),

Experience in preparing Test data by retrieving data from Relational Databases Oracle, MS-SQL.

Working knowledge in UNIX commands.

Automated manual test cases using functional testing tools selenium and test complete.

Expertise in Raising Defects based on Requirements and Coding Standards.

Excellent analytical skills with good communication and self-organizing skills, assertive and a committed team player.

TECHNICAL SKILLS

Test Approaches

Waterfall, Agile/Scrum, SDLC, STLC, Bug Life Cycle

Tools

Selenium WebDriver, TestNG, Selenium IDE, Selenium RC, Selenium Grid, Rational Robot, Test Complete, JUnit, Cucumber, SoapUI, Informatica, QC, QTP/UFT

Test Build& Integration Tools

Maven, ANT, Jenkins

Frameworks

Keyword Driven, Data Driven, Hybrid, Page Object Model (POM)

Programming Tools

JAVA, JavaScript, Angular JS, VB Script, Gherkin, SQL C, C++, Python

Markup Languages

HTML, XML, XPath, CssSelector

Databases

MySQL, Oracle, SQL Server, Mongo DB

Browsers

Internet Explorer, Mozilla Firefox, Google Chrome, Safari

Operating Systems

Windows 7/8, Ubuntu, UNIX, LINUX

Defect Tools

HP Quality Center, JIRA, ALM, TFS

MS Office Tools

Outlook, Word, Excel, PowerPoint, MS Access

Utilities

Eclipse, GIT, SVN, Firebug, Fire Path

WORK EXPERIENCE

Client : Financial Partners

Role : Senior QA Automation Engineer Oct 2017 to Present

Location: Agawam, Massachusetts

Description:

Financial Partners is premium technology provider, providing Collaborative, Innovative and Passionate Quality Solutions in the Farm Credit System. Worked in Farm Credit West Risk Matrix project and Supported Onboarding team to join Farm Credit Illinois and Fresno-Madera Associations into FPI Family.

Responsibilities:

Gathered requirements, organized team meetings requirements from Credit Associations such as creating new actions and transactions.

Created workflow diagrams, flowcharts, activity diagrams, and use-case diagrams using MS Visio. Understood user requirements, and test-objectives to develop test plans, test cases, and use-case scenarios.

Co-authored business requirements specification(BRS), use-case specifications, traceability mapping / matrix, and systems requirement specification (SRS) with the business group, and the IT team members. Conducted User Acceptance Testing (UAT), Unit Testing and System Testing. Assisted in developing test scenarios, test scripts and test data to support unit and system integration testing. Involved in testing of the system to check it satisfies functional specifications.

Prepared individual test plans for different modules of Narratives and Credit Underwriting Packages.

Performed GUI testing to verify web application quality with regards to Industry standards.

Tested functionality using Chrome, Edge browsers to ensure cross-browser compatibility.

Developed SQL-Queries/procedures for database and backend testing of PIA data of Sold Loans, Account Information and Collaterals.

Performed functional testing of web application elements based on specific test data in DNA(Dot Net Application)

Performed Security Profile, comprehensive regression testing of new builds providing feedback to QA manager / developers team.

Identified bugs by interacting with developers, system engineers, testing teams and provided feedback / statistics on weekly Scrum meetings

Reported bugs to TFS environment with further tracking and validations of files issued by developers.

Designed and created automation test scripts in Test Complete and run them.

Used Beyond Compare to do validation of different business specifications in the application.

Tested Performance of the application using Dynatrace.

Developed Project Status metrics for weekly evaluation of Project Status and impact of the Change request on the Time line.

Contributing to software process-reengineering efforts aimed at evolving current software development practices to adopt Lean/Agile and Scrum practices.

Assisted in the development, design and implementation of new relational or multi-dimensional databases, including the analysis of user needs.

Environment: Microsoft SQL server, Microsoft Team Foundation Server(TFS), Test Complete, Beyond Compare, Microsoft Test Manager, Visual Studio, Windows, Chrome, IE, Fastone Tracker, Dynatrace, My SQL

Client : OSF Healthcare System

Role : Senior QA Automation Engineer Jan 2016 to Sept 2017

Location: Peoria, Illinois

Description:

OSF Healthcare System mainly consists of different modules like system admin module, create employee module, patient module, bill plan, policy, bill claim, doctor scheduling. In this project I have worked on different modules for developing and automating end-end and regression test suites of the application diagnosing the patient demographic information and claims submission.

Responsibilities:

Participated in identifying the Test scenarios and designing the Test cases.

Demonstrated ability to solve complex automation challenges involving Ajax, dynamic objects, custom object types, unexpected event handling. Interacted with development and product management teams for the quick resolution of reported bugs and various technical issues.

Performed Cross Browser compatibility testing on Chrome, Firefox, IE browsers using Selenium Grid with Sause Labs Cloud Integration on various mobile devices.

Understanding requirement and developing end to end automation test scripts using selenium WebDriver with TestNG framework.

Developed and maintained automated regression test cases in Selenium WebDriver using Java

Used Maven build tool to implement the framework dependency jar files.

Executed test cases relating to mouse hover using Action class and found hidden elements id, name, cssSelector, xpath, className, linkText, using the firebug and firepath.

Saved remarkable time and cost of testing by automation using Selenium WebDriver, JAVA.

Performed BDD (Behavior Driven Development) using Cucumber Features, Scenarios and Step definitions in Gherkin format.

Implemented the selenium synchronization using wait and sleep methods.

Implemented test automation for handling pop-ups and alerts on webpage.

Used updated extent reports dependencies to generate more pictorial reports.

Maintained the Java and selenium test source code and resources in the GIT source control repository tool.

Analyzed test results, tracked the defects and generated reports using JIRA.

Performed UAT testing by developing BDD (behavioral driven development) using Cucumber.

Examined the performance of the application under different loads using Jmeter.

Used Apache POI to read data from Excel sheets and testing the test scenarios.

Used Jenkins tool for continuous integration server to configure with GitHub and Maven.

Involved in Developing and creating detailed test plans and test cases for the system covering design document, reviewing them with the developers and finalizing the test cases.

Performed functional testing of SOAP and RESTFUL API’s using SOAP UI Tool.

Tested API protocols that share information with in-house or with third parties for security.

Prepared user documentation with screenshots for UAT (User Acceptance testing).

Environment

Environment: : Java, Selenium WebDriver, TestNG, Apache POI, Extent Reports, ETL Informatica, Cucumber, Eclipse, Windows, Oracle, Maven, SQL server, JIRA, SOAP UI

Client : Trans Union

Role : Senior QA Engineer Apr 2014 to Dec 2015

Location: Chicago, Illinois

Description:

Trans Union is the third largest credit bureau in the United States offering various services to customers like Credit Rating, Fraud Detection and Prevention, Healthcare Revenue Cycle Management and Credit Solutions. In this project we have mainly worked on mocking of data from different databases and validating them for different transactions based on the credit rating of the consumer.

Responsibilities:

Analyzing business requirements and discussing requirements with business analyst.

Prepared test plan and test strategy documents.

Designing the Test scenarios according to the given requirements.

Created and mocked up test data in DB2 and designed test cases according to data mapping sheet.

Interacted with development team for clarifications.

Extensively worked on designing the test plans and developing the test cases for newly developed functionalities.

Executed the web-service test cases using SOAP UI tools.

Validated the customer account records and their order details with Databases using SQL Queries.

Worked with the functionality and Regression testing cycles of major product releases by developing test suite using selenium Webdriver.

Involved in distributed test automation as a part of integration testing using Jenkins.

Executed both positive and negative Test cases of functionality and Regression Tests.

Prepared the Test Suite with the TestNG framework based on Java and developed the test scripts using TestNG annotations.

Extensively worked with End-to-end testing for User Acceptance Testing (UAT).

Executed ETL jobs to load the data from source to target and validated informatica log files.

Designed complicated DB2 queries for comparing source and target tables.

Assigned tasks to team members .

Logged defects in HP ALM and tracked defects.

Shared daily status report and weekly status reports with client stake holders.

Environment: Selenium IDE, Webdriver, selenium grid, Eclipse IDE, Java, SQL server, MY-SQL, SVN, HP Quality Center, SOAP UI, TestNG, HTML, XML, Informatica, Windows, IE9, Chrome and Firefox, ETL.

Client : Molina HealthCare

Role : Senior QA Engineer Feb 2013 to Mar 2014

Location: Long Beach, California

Description:

Medicaid Molina Healthcare contracts with state governments and serves as health plan, providing a wide range of quality healthcare services to families and individuals who qualified for government-sponsored programs including Medicaid and State Children's Health Insurance program (SCHIP). As a QA I have involved in testing the application from UAT level by developing frameworks, designing and deploying virtual services.

Responsibilities:

Prepared automation test scripts to validate various functionalities using Selenium WebDriver using Java.

Experienced in designing customized Hybrid framework, Keyword Driven, Data Driven & POM in order to make maintenance process easier and achieve efficiency, re-usability and accuracy across applications.

Expertise in designing, developing, deploying and supporting of Service Virtualization using CA LISA DevTest.

Implemented open source tool Appium, Selenium Web Driver for cross browser and cross platform web/Mobile testing.

Experience with working in short sprints in an Agile Scrum software development model.

Maintained the Selenium & Java Automation Code and resources in source controls like Jenkins for improvements and new features.

Document software defects, and bug tracking using QC/ALM, and report defects to software developers.

Created web UI tests using Cucumber, Gherkin, Selenium WebDriver.

Work with Teams to create Acceptance Test Driven development (ATDD) test suite using Ruby and Cucumber.

Coordinated efforts between product development teams and offshore enterprise test team. Standardized QA standards and practices across teams where possible. Involve in BDD framework using cucumber .

Developed test plan, test cases, execution of test cases, reporting, tracking defect using HP Quality Center/ALM.

Usage of Ruby, cucumber in project to create and validate the test cases.

The entire Ruby scripting done using Cucumber framework Wrote and executed SQL queries to verify the data updates to various tables and ensure data integrity.

Utilized SVN repository in order to perform efficient remote team working. Checked in all tested PL/SQL code in SVN and maintaining versions of PL/SQL codes.

Experienced in integrating server side java code with UI components using JSON, XML and used AJAX & JSON communication against RESTful web services.

Developed automation framework and scripts for End to End (e2e) testing using Selenium WebDriver and JavaScript.

Involved in Installing Jenkins on a Linux machine and created a master and slave configuration to implement multiple parallel builds through a build farm.

Used JDBC to invoke Stored Procedures and database connectivity to Oracle.

Written several SQL queries and analyzed them to validate the business rules in Oracle database through SQL Developer as part of Backend testing.

Environment: Java, Angular JS, BPM, Hybrid Framework, ATTD, CA LISA, TestNG, POM, QC/ALM, Cucumber, Jenkins, SOAP and REST, JSON, XML, Oracle, RFT, SQL, SVN,PL/SQL, ruby, Quality Center.

Client : British Telecom

Role : QA Test Engineer Aug 2011 to Dec 2012

Location: London, United Kingdom

Description:

British Telecom is a Telecom based project. BT runs the telephone exchanges, trunk network and local loop connections for the vast majority of British fixed-line telephones. It has different lines of business like wholesale, retail, Global Services etc. I worked as a Functional and Automation Test engineer in RETAIL Team for many products like switch, PSTN variants like single line, multi-line, value line and for broad-band, cloud voice, BT sports, mobile etc.

Responsibilities:

Obtaining KT for the relevant Web Based Application.

Understanding the Technical Analysis Documents from Client team.

Created Test plan, Test Scenarios (High and low level )Test scripts, Regression Packs and Automation Packs.

Executed test scripts, Regression Packs and Automation Packs.

Logged and maintained defects.

Getting Sign Off and Sending the Test closure Report status to supervisor and onsite.

Handled 3 successful CR releases without having post production defects.

Worked on Sibel (one view 7.1) as Front End and UNIX box for executing scripts and ORACLE Database (9i) and SQL Developer as Back End.

Experience working with Cross Vendors, Sub vendors.

Experience handling onshore calls.

Working experience in Metrics environment - metrics that are generated in a project such as Daily Automated Test Report, daily status metric, weekly metric, defect due to off- shore and on-shore.

Environment: Quality Center, QTP/UFT, Load runner, MS Access, ETL Informatica, MS SQL Server, My SQL, Oracle, Windows-XP.



Contact this candidate